Growth & profitability

  • Revenue has grown 6.4% per year over the past 4 years.

Financial health

  • Total debt ($198M) exceeds cash ($8M); net debt is $190M.
  • Total debt has grown faster than revenue (21.1% vs 6.4% per year).

Frequently asked questions

Is BEEP growing its revenue and profit?

Over the past 4 years, Mobile Infrastructure Corp's revenue has grown 6.4% per year. These are computed facts, not advice.

How much debt does BEEP have?

As of FY2025, Mobile Infrastructure Corp reported $198M of total debt against $8M of cash.

What is BEEP's profit margin?

In FY2025, gross margin was —, operating margin —, and net margin -61.1%.
